!! OMG, WATCH: Netflix releases trailer for new Martin Short documentary, ‘Marty, Life Is Short’ !!

Netflix just dropped the trailer for Marty, Life Is Short, a documentary celebrating the one and only Martin Short, and it looks wonderful.

Directed by Lawrence Kasdan, the film blends never-before-seen archival footage with interviews from some of Short’s closest friends and collaborators — Steve Martin, Eugene Levy, and the late Catherine O’Hara (RIP, QUEEN), among others.

The trailer details how this man has been making people laugh for over five decades, from his SCTV days to Only Murders in the Building. Marty, Life Is Short hits Netflix on May 12 — mark your calendars. Check out the trailer above! Thoughts?

!! OMG, quote of the day: Lisa Kudrow on the male group of writers who worked on FRIENDS !!

“There was definitely mean stuff going on behind the scenes,” Kudrow said. “Don’t forget we were recording in front of a live audience of 400, and if you messed up one of these writers’ lines or it didn’t get the perfect response they could be like, ‘Can’t the bitch fucking read? She’s not even trying. She fucked up my line.’”

Additionally, Kudrow said the writing staffers, who were “mostly men,” also made sexually charged comments about her female costars, Jennifer Aniston and Courteney Cox
